Maybe someone can shed some light on the best way to put a field reference into a variable (or custom property).


If I do this:

  set the uFldRef of me to the long name of fld "whatever"

It seems to work great.


Then, if I try to access that custom property:

  put the uFldRef of the target into tFldIWant

it seems to work fine.


But when I try to do something, like:

  put the text of fld tFldIWant into x -- error

or

  put the text of tFldIWant into x - error

This last one should work.

Try doing an "answer tFldIWant" before using the variable as a field reference. Maybe it's empty. Maybe the uFldRef was stored as the custom prop of some object other than the one you think. If so, that could cause the problem.

I tried a test using the last approach listed above & it works fine here.
